What Are Bio-Based Plastics?

Let's get the right picture: bio-based plastics, unlike their petroleum-based counterparts, are derived from biological substances. Think corn starch, sugarcane, or even algae. Instead of drilling into the Earth, we're tapping into its renewable bounty for materials that can be compostable and biodegradable.

Why Bio-Based?

  • Sustainability: Made from renewable resources, these plastics cut down on greenhouse gas emissions.
  • Decomposition: Many bio-based plastics can decompose more easily than conventional plastics. End-of-life disposal becomes less of a nightmare for future generations.
  • Innovation: They open up new avenues in product design, from packaging to automotive parts.

According to the European Bioplastics organization, the production potential of bio-based plastics could exceed 44 million tonnes by 2024, a clear testament to their gaining traction (European Bioplastics [link]).

Enter Mushroom Leather

Picture this: you're wearing a jacket not made from cowhide, but from mushrooms. Yes, you read that right. Mushroom leather—or mycelium leather—emerges as a futuristic, vegan-friendly, and fully biodegradable alternative to traditional leather. It’s more than just a quirky concept; it’s revolutionary.

How is Mushroom Leather Made?

  1. Cultivation: Mycelium, the root structure of mushrooms, is grown in controlled environments.
  2. Harvesting: Once matured, it's treated with non-toxic processes to mimic the texture and durability of traditional leather.
  3. Application: The potential uses are limitless, from fashion and furniture to car interiors.

Brands like Stella McCartney and Adidas are already exploring mushroom leather, suggesting that its commercial viability is around the corner (Fast Company [link]).

Challenges in the Path

Of course, it's not all smooth sailing. The adoption of these materials is fraught with challenges that need resolution.

Cost Implications

Producing bio-based materials is expensive—for now. Over time, as processes scale and improve, we anticipate these costs will decrease, making such materials more accessible.

Consumer Awareness

Another hurdle is educating the consumer. How many people are aware of what bio-based plastics are, or the fact that their next luxury handbag could be made from mushrooms? Awareness must increase for mass adoption to take place.

Infrastructure Adaptation

For bio-based materials to become the norm, infrastructure—from waste management systems to manufacturing processes—needs to adapt. This transition will require policymaking, investment, and time.
